## Waveform Preview Troubleshooting

When a customer reports a blank waveform preview in Soundrail Studio, first confirm the render job completed in the Peakline dashboard. If the job shows "stalled," requeue it from the Actions menu; rendering usually finishes within two minutes. Previews older than 90 days are purged and must be regenerated manually. To requeue in bulk, call the Peakline render endpoint with the support tier credential. The key for that service is below.

gateway credential: zpat15_lMLOSdhT94y0U3l

**Night Shift — Recording Studio (Room 4B)**

The Fennick Media training studio runs unattended overnight. Check the booking sheet before entering. Power down lights and teleprompter after any maintenance. Do not move camera rigs; they are marked on the floor. Report faults in the night log, not by phone. Lock the equipment cage before leaving. The studio door uses a keypad; enter with the code below.

badge for fahap-kahof: bdg-EQUNTN-00774017

## Deployment

The Murdock thumbnail queue runs as a single worker pool behind the Ostrell broker. Deploy by pushing the image and restarting the pool; in-flight jobs are requeued automatically. Do not scale above four workers — the image store rate-limits and jobs will thrash. Failed thumbnails land in the retry bucket with a three-attempt cap. Logs go to the shared sink under the worker hostname. On boot, each worker reads the following configuration.

deployment values, bafog-yaguf:
[julvan]
team = praix
access_code = ac_0696c8
host = julvan.sivrelsoft.corp
port = 5000
owner = casvan.novix
peer = aldix.zemvartech.example